To make concrete in Minecraft, follow these steps:

Materials Needed

  • 4 blocks of sand
  • 4 blocks of gravel
  • 1 dye of any color (this determines the color of the concrete)

Crafting Concrete Powder

  1. Open your crafting table.
  2. Place the 4 sand blocks, 4 gravel blocks, and 1 dye anywhere in the crafting grid (the order does not matter).
  3. This will yield 8 blocks of concrete powder colored according to the dye used

Turning Concrete Powder into Concrete

  1. Place the concrete powder blocks so they come into contact with water (such as in a river, ocean, or water source block).
  2. When concrete powder touches water, it instantly hardens into solid concrete blocks.
  3. You can also pour water over placed concrete powder to convert it.
  4. Concrete powder behaves like sand and gravel and will fall if unsupported, so it can fall into water and convert automatically

Harvesting Concrete

  • Use a pickaxe to mine the solid concrete blocks.
  • Efficiency enchantments or haste effects speed up mining

Tips for Making Large Amounts Quickly

  • Build a platform over water and place concrete powder on it to convert many blocks at once.
  • Use techniques like placing water under a dirt platform with concrete powder on top to convert large quantities efficiently

This process works in both Java and Bedrock editions of Minecraft and allows you to create vibrant, non-flammable building blocks in 16 different colors
